'Vert tops
Look up Robbins tops, they seem to be a good well known brand, also at one time they would list installers that use Robbins brand around the nation.
By the way by shopping around years ago, I found out by asking if I can hang out at the shop, because I lived over an hour away and had no ride home.
Anyways a shop in Scottsdale AZ had to admit he would drive my car to another place to have the work done, he wouldn’t say where exactly but it was in Phoenix, and my car may be there more than one day.
First off the guy is just a middle man, 2nd who knows how many people are going to be joy riding my car, is it going to be parked out on a street or parking lot in a sketchy area?
I think Robbins gives instructions on how to install their tops, sounds like you need a staple gun, spray adhesive and lots patience.
They also have an option for non heated rear glass for about $40.00 less.
